The chills you sometimes feel when listening to music is called "musical frisson."

In 2007, Joshua Bell pretended to be a street violinist and went mostly ignored. Just two days earlier, he played in a sold out theater with each seat costing $100. The violin he used on the street was worth 3.5 million dollars.

The Beatles wrote into their contracts for American concerts that they would not play in front of segregated audiences.

There's a road in Lancaster, CA that has grooves carved in such a way that when you drive over them at 55 MPH, they will play a part of Rossini's "The William Tell Overture."
